Criminal Justice Clients - Broadview Heights

Drug or alcohol rehabilitation is sometimes a part of a criminal justice clients court sentence. In order to get these individuals the rehabilitation they need, there are a few specific steps that should be followed before they can enroll into a drug treatment program. First, they need to determine if they are eligible for drug treatment during their time in the Broadview Heights, Ohio criminal justice system. Their case is reviewed by a panel who decides if they are in need of rehabilitation and if so how much and what type is necessary. Additionally, when the client is screened for drug addiction problems, the client is also screened for mental health problems as well. Severity of addiction, mental health problems, criminal activity, sentence length and previous substance abuse history are all determining variables in the creation of the rehabilitation plan.
